Source: FMCSA Licensing & Insurance (L&I), public data. This shows the carrier’s federal insurance filings (BMC-91X liability, BMC-34 cargo) — the federally-required minimums on file for operating authority — not the carrier’s full commercial policy (its actual auto combined-single-limit, general liability, cargo, or workers’ comp, which appear on the carrier’s ACORD certificate of insurance). Always confirm current coverage with a COI from the carrier’s agent before making a vetting decision.

CSA points = violation severity weight × FMCSA time weight (3× in the last 6 months, 2× at 6–12, 1× at 12–24). Points are spread within each state — FMCSA records the inspection state, not an exact location. Source: FMCSA MCMIS.

Shared VINs come from FMCSA roadside-inspection records — a vehicle inspected under more than one carrier, often a fleet transfer or trailer interchange. Other links come from the FMCSA census. Shared identifiers are common and often legitimate — treat these as leads to investigate, not proof of wrongdoing.
